  • "Confidential Information" means and includes: (a) the Know-How; (b) the Business Data; (c) the terms of the Franchise Agreement and all related agreements signed by Franchisee in connection with the Restaurant, and all attachments thereto and amendments thereof; (d) the components of the System; (e) all information within or comprising the Manual; and (f) all other concepts, ideas, trade secrets, financial information, marketing strategies, expansion strategies, studies, supplier information, customer information, franchisee information, investor information, flow charts, inventions, mask works, improvements, discoveries, standards, specifications, formulae, recipes, designs, sketches, drawings, policies, processes, procedures, methodologies and techniques, together with analyses, compilations, studies or other documents that: (i) are designated as confidential; (ii) are known by you to be considered confidential by us; and/or (iii) are by their nature inherently or reasonably to be considered confidential.

Confidential Information does not include any information that: (a) is now, or subsequently becomes, generally available to the public (except as a result of a breach of confidentiality obligations by you, Franchisee or Franchisee's owners, employees or other constituents); (b) you can demonstrate was rightfully in your possession, without obligation of nondisclosure, before the information was disclosed to you by us or Franchisee (or any person associated with us or Franchisee); (c) is independently developed by you without any use of, or reference to, any Confidential Information; or (d) is rightfully obtained from a third party who has the right to transfer or disclose such information to you without breaching any obligation of confidentiality imposed on such third party.

What This Means (2024 FDD)

According to Chop5 Salad Kitchen's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, the definition of "Confidential Information" does include trade secrets. The FDD specifies that Confidential Information includes, but is not limited to, concepts, ideas, trade secrets, financial information, marketing and expansion strategies, studies, and various other business-related data. This broad definition ensures that a wide array of sensitive information pertaining to Chop5 Salad Kitchen's operations is protected.

This definition extends to information designated as confidential, known to be considered confidential by the franchisor, or inherently considered confidential due to its nature. However, the definition also carves out exceptions for information that is publicly available, rightfully possessed by the franchisee before disclosure, independently developed by the franchisee, or rightfully obtained from a third party without breaching confidentiality obligations.

For a prospective Chop5 Salad Kitchen franchisee, this means they are obligated to protect a wide range of information related to the franchise. This obligation extends not only to the franchisee but also to their owners and employees. Understanding the scope and limitations of what constitutes Confidential Information is crucial for franchisees to avoid potential breaches and legal repercussions.
